What is a Filter Cartridge Dust Collector?
A filter cartridge dust collector is a sophisticated air filtration system designed to capture airborne particulates, ensuring cleaner air quality in the workplace. The fundamental principle behind these systems is the use of cylindrical filter cartridges, which are made from advanced materials that can effectively trap dust and debris of varying sizes. As air flows through the collector, dust particles are deposited onto the outside of the cartridges. Once the cartridges are saturated with dust, a cleaning mechanism, often utilizing pulsed compressed air, removes the accumulated particles, allowing the system to maintain optimal performance.
Advantages of Filter Cartridge Systems
1. High Efficiency Filter cartridge dust collectors are known for their exceptional efficiency. They can capture particles as small as 0.5 microns with a high filtration efficiency rate, often exceeding 99%. This makes them suitable for various industries, including woodworking, metalworking, pharmaceuticals, and food processing.
2. Compact Design Unlike traditional baghouse collectors, filter cartridge systems are significantly more compact. This smaller footprint allows them to be installed in tighter spaces, making them ideal for facilities where real estate is at a premium.
3. Lower Maintenance Requirements The design of filter cartridges simplifies maintenance. Unlike bag filters that often require frequent replacements, cartridge filters can last longer and are easier to clean. Many systems incorporate automatic cleaning mechanisms, further reducing the need for manual intervention and downtime.
4. Cost-Effectiveness Although the initial investment in a filter cartridge dust collector may be higher than that of traditional systems, their efficiency and lower maintenance costs often lead to considerable savings in the long run. Furthermore, improved air quality can lead to fewer health-related absences, enhancing overall productivity.
5. Environmental Compliance With stringent regulations governing air quality, having an effective dust collection system is essential for compliance with environmental standards. Filter cartridge dust collectors help businesses avoid hefty fines and contribute to a cleaner environment.
Applications Across Industries
Filter cartridge dust collectors are versatile and can be used in a wide range of applications. In the woodworking industry, for example, these systems effectively capture sawdust and wood particles, ensuring a safer work environment. In metalworking, they control metal shavings and grinding dust, which can be both a health hazard and a fire risk. Similarly, in food processing and pharmaceuticals, maintaining cleanliness is paramount, and cartridge dust collectors help achieve the necessary hygiene standards.
